🥘 Ingredients

9 items
  • 4 pieces Cod fillets
  • 1 cup Cherry tomatoes
  • 3 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 2 cloves Garlic
  • 1 whole Lemon
  • 4 sprigs Fresh thyme
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 4 sheets Parchment paper or aluminum foil

📝 Instructions

13 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).

2

Cut 4 sheets of parchment paper or aluminum foil, each large enough to fully wrap a cod fillet and accompanying ingredients.

3

Place one cod fillet in the center of each sheet of paper or foil.

4

Halve the cherry tomatoes and distribute evenly around the cod fillets.

5

Finely chop or mince the garlic and sprinkle it over the fish and tomatoes.

6

Drizzle 1 tablespoon of olive oil over each fillet, ensuring a light coating for moisture and flavor.

7

Cut the lemon in half. Squeeze half the lemon over the fish and tomatoes, and thinly slice the other half. Place a lemon slice on top of each fillet.

8

Add one sprig of fresh thyme to each packet for a burst of aromatic flavor.

9

Season everything with salt and black pepper to taste.

10

Fold the parchment or foil around the fish and vegetables to create a sealed packet, ensuring no steam escapes during cooking.

11

Place the packets on a baking sheet and b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es, or until the cod is opaque and flakes easily with a fork.

12

Carefully open the packets (steam will escape, so take caution) and transfer the contents to a serving plate.

13

Garnish with additional fresh herbs or a squeeze of lemon if desired before serving.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(167.0g)
Calories
197
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 11.0 g 14%
Saturated Fat 1.7 g 8%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 48 mg 16%
Sodium 548 mg 24%
Total Carbohydrate 5.0 g 2%
Dietary Fiber 1.5 g 5%
Total Sugars 1.7 g
Protein 20.2 g 40%
Vitamin D 5.0 mcg 25%
Calcium 29 mg 2%
Iron 0.8 mg 5%
Potassium 485 mg 10%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
